DAS (FULL MOTORCYCLE LICENCE)

If you are aged 24 or over or held an A2 licence for two years you can get an unrestricted motorcycle licence by taking a Direct Access (DAS) course and test. A full bike licence entitling you to ride any size of machine is gained through this course. After completing your CBT your training continues and once you are proficient enough, you progress onto a 650 cc motorcycle (Suzuki Gladius 650 cc) which you will take your tests on.

You will need to have a valid theory test certificate and if you don’t already hold a valid CBT certificate you will need to complete a CBT first. Motorcycle Licence – A1

If you are aged 19 or over you can get a restricted full motorcycle licence by taking an A1 Licence course and test. A restricted full bike licence entitling you to ride a motorcycle or a scooter up to 125cc (up to 11 BHP) is gained through this course/test. After completing your CBT, your training continues and once you are proficient enough, you progress onto a 125cc motorcycle or a scooter, whichever you prefer, which you will take your tests on.

You will need to have a valid theory test certificate and if you don’t already hold a valid CBT certificate you will need to complete a CBT first. Motorcycle Licence – A2

If you are aged 19 or over you can get a restricted full motorcycle licence by taking an A2 Licence course and test. A restricted full bike licence entitling you to ride a motorcycle or a scooter up to 500cc (or a bike restricted to 46 BHP or less) is gained through this course/test. After completing your CBT, your training continues and once you are proficient enough, you progress onto a 500cc motorcycle or a scooter, whichever you prefer, which you will take your tests on.

You will need to have a valid motorcycle theory test certificate and if you don’t already hold a valid CBT certificate you will need to complete a CBT first. Motorcycle Licence – ENHANCED RIDER SCHEME (ERS) DVSA

The DVSA Enhanced Rider Scheme (ERS) checks your motorcycle riding skills and provides training to help you improve. There is no test. Once you’ve successfully completed the scheme you will get a “DVSA Certificate of Competence” and you can use it to get discounts on motorcycle insurance.

You can take the enhanced rider scheme, if you’re a fully licensed motorcyclist and have passed your test.

The scheme will be suitable if you either:

  • have just passed your full motorcycle licence test or
  • are returning to riding after a break or
  • are upgrading to a more powerful motorcycle or
  • want to check and improve your motorcycle riding standard
